John Cena has confirmed plans for the WWE John Cena Classic are a "work in progress" but the 17-time world champion is invested in bringing the concept to fruition.

"Oh my God, I'm super excited. It's something I've been thinking about for a long time. And, again, we're still working things out. And I like that, I like that it’s a work in progress. But this is absolutely from me. I can't tell you how excited I am about it. I am fully invested in this. I can't wait to see what it is. I can't wait until we announce the date and location. That's obviously step one, and we'll go from there," Cena told Adam's Apple.

Cena announced the John Cena Classic during an appearance at the Backlash pay-per-view. The event will feature main roster wrestlers against NXT talents, similar to the December 13, 2025 episode of Saturday Night's Main Event that featured Cena's retirement match. There will also be a John Cena Classic Championship, although the champion will be determined by fan vote as opposed to in a professional wrestling match.

WrestleVotes Radio on Fightful Select has reported that no date or venue for the John Cena Classic appears to have been nailed down, but one source noted the event taking place in December appeared to make logistical sense for WWE's calendar and it being around the one-year anniversary of John Cena's retirement.

How the John Cena Classic will air has also not been finalised, but Netflix immediately expressed interest in the show being broadcast on the streaming platform.
